Transaction dbb567438b38df95d2521da1a859e26bb0dde80e68fe70d2df0603b2113b5916
1 Input
1 Output
-
dbb567438b38df95d2521da1a859e26bb0dde80e68fe70d2df0603b2113b5916:0
- value
- 3035
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e70e410de218909e265942e6fd7a7ea1cf44c6e
- address
- bc1qrecwgyx7yxysncn9jshxl4a8agw0gnrwt4jwtr